Abstract
Changes in the spin orientation in cold-rolled Fe-12 at% Si alloy samp les were studied by means of the Mossbauer effect. In the deformed str ucture two components were distinguished: high dislocation density reg ions (HDDRs) and original crystalline structure with low dislocation d ensity. It is shown that spins are reoriented by cold-rolling toward t he sheet plane and rolling direction in both components but in HDDRs t his orientation is more pronounced. The results indicate that HDDRs ha ve the dominating influence on the spin reorientation in the whole vol ume of the sample.
